Snoring is not just a human phenomenon; dogs, including Boston Terriers, often snore too. This happens because of their unique anatomy and breathing patterns during deep sleep. Boston Terriers, known for their flat faces and short snouts, are particularly prone to gentle snoring. Their playful personalities make these moments especially endearing to pet owners. When you hear a dog snoring softly, it's usually a sign that they are in a deep, restful sleep, which is important for their health and recovery after active play. However, excessive or loud snoring in dogs can sometimes indicate health issues like respiratory problems or allergies. Pet owners should pay attention to changes in their dog's snoring patterns and consult a veterinarian if concerned.
